About Freight Technologies

(Get Free Report)

Freight Technologies, Inc., through its subsidiary, operates a transportation logistics technology platform for cross-border shipping in the United States and Mexico. Its Fr8App technology platform offers an online portal and a mobile application that provide third-party logistics services to companies in the freight transportation market; a transport management solution for customers to manage their own fleet; and freight brokerage support and customer services based on the platform. The company was incorporated in 2015 and is headquartered in The Woodlands, Texas.

About Österreichische Post

(Get Free Report)

Österreichische Post AG, together with its subsidiaries, provides postal and parcel services in Austria, Germany, Southeast and Eastern Europe, Türkiye, Azerbaijan, and internationally. It operates through three divisions: Mail, Parcel & Logistics, and Retail & Bank. The Mail division engages in the distribution, collection, sorting, and delivery of letters and document shipments, addressed and unaddressed direct mail, and newspapers and magazines, as well as online services, such as e-letter and cross-media solutions. This division also provides physical and digital services in customer communications and document processing. The Parcel & Logistics division offers solutions for parcel products, express delivery, and food delivery; stationary logistics for pharmaceutical products; and value-added services, including warehousing, order picking, returns management, and web shop logistics and infrastructure, as well as cash and valuable goods transportation services. The Retail & Bank division is involved in the distribution of telecommunication products, and merchandise; financial services, such as payment transaction services, bank accounts, transfer services, consumer loans, investment and saving options, housing finance, and insurance; and self-service solutions, such as pick-up and drop-off stations at various locations. The company was incorporated in 1999 and is headquartered in Vienna, Austria. Oesterreichische Post AG is a subsidiary of Österreichische Beteiligungs AG.
